During the Great World War II, in order to guard their complexes from spies, the Soviets trained and kept attack dogs. In order to sustain their population, specialized structures called kennels were constructed. The kennel was the place where, when not on duty, dogs could rest and eat before their next assignment as well as where Soviet trainers could train their dogs.

Attack dogs were also used in the Great World War III, although kennels were no longer needed; the dogs were trained in the barracks. The attack dogs were mostly used to guard Soviet bases from infiltration by Allied spies. However, the Allies saw the potential of attack dogs and began to use them too, although in much smaller numbers than the Soviets did.
